Influence of Concanavalin A, wheat germ agglutinin, and soybean agglutinin on the fusion of myoblasts in vitro
Although muscle cell fusion was shown to be an energy-requiring process, release of myoblasts from an EGTA fusion block could be accomplished with Earle's balanced salt solution (containing 1.8 mM Ca++) free of glucose or any other energy-produced metabolite. متن کاملWheat Germ Agglutinin
Procedures for the isolation, purification, and crystallization of wheat germ agglutinin are described. The agglutinin was purified 184-fold to homogeneity from commercial wheat germ lipase. A molecular weight of 23,500 was estimated for the protein by means of sedimentation equilibrium and sodium dodecyl sulfate gel electrophoresis. The agghxtinin is a glycoprotein. متن کاملDrosophila cell fusion induced by wheat germ agglutinin.
The effects of wheat germ agglutinin on Drosophila embryonic cell lines growing on cover-glasses was examined by scanning electron microscopy. At low concentrations of the lectin (5-10 mug/ml), cells spread against the glass surface and fused to form syncytia. متن کاملEmbryonic and neoplastic cell surfaces: availability of receptors for concanavalin A and wheat germ agglutinin.
Embryonic tissue cells dissociated with ethylenediaminetetraacetate are readily agglutinated by the carbohydrate-binding protein concanavalin A. In this property, they resemble transformed, neoplastic cells; and they differ from untransformed adult cells, which are agglutinated by concanavalin A only after their receptors are unmasked by proteolytic treatment. متن کاملMechanism of neutrophil chemiluminescence induced by wheat germ agglutinin: partial characterization of the antigens recognized by wheat germ agglutinin.
Wheat germ agglutinin (WGA) stimulated neutrophils to produce significant levels of luminol-dependent chemiluminescence (CL). Since WGA is known to bind N-acetylglucosamine (GlcNAc) oligomers and N-acetylneuraminic acid (NANA), we attempted to determine which binding property of WGA is essential for induction of CL.
